LWP-DOWNLOAD(1p)               User Contributed Perl Documentation               LWP-DOWNLOAD(1p)



NAME
       lwp-download - Fetch large files from the web

SYNOPSIS
       lwp-download [-a] <url> [<local path>]

DESCRIPTION
       The lwp-download program will save the file at url to a local file.

       If local path is not specified, then the current directory is assumed.

       If local path is a directory, then the basename of the file to save is picked up from the
       Content-Disposition header or the URL of the response.  If the file already exists, then
       lwp-download will prompt before it overwrites and will fail if its standard input is not a
       terminal.  This form of invocation will also fail is no acceptable filename can be derived
       from the sources mentioned above.

       If local path is not a directory, then it is simply used as the path to save into.

       The lwp-download program is implemented using the libwww-perl library.  It is better
       suited to down load big files than the lwp-request program because it does not store the
       file in memory.  Another benefit is that it will keep you updated about its progress and
       that you don't have much options to worry about.

       Use the "-a" option to save the file in text (ascii) mode.  Might make a difference on
       dosish systems.

EXAMPLE
       Fetch the newest and greatest perl version:

        $ lwp-download http://www.perl.com/CPAN/src/latest.tar.gz
        Saving to 'latest.tar.gz'...
        11.4 MB received in 8 seconds (1.43 MB/sec)
